Stop At: Donghai Bridge, S 2 Hu Lu Gao Su, Shengsi Xian, Zhoushan Shi, Zhejiang Sheng, China

Donghai Bridge, sometimes called East Sea Grand Bridge, it is the first sea-crossing bridge in China, the third longest sea bridge in China and the forth longest sea bridge in the World.
The Donghai Bridge connects the mainland to Yangshan Deep-water Port. The bridge is 32.5 kilometers long, the bridge deck is two-way six-lane expressway. Donghai Bridge is designed into an S-shaped because of the safety issue. Donghai Bridge gets a 100-year service guaranteed with an 80km/h speed limit.
We can see rows of windmill generators from the bridge.

Stop At: Yangshan Deepwater Harbor, No.1998 Laolu Road, Pudong New Area, Shanghai 200135 China

Yangshan Deep Water Port, located close to a chain of islands between the Hangzhou Bay and the mouth of the Yangtze River. A natural and superb deepwater port, it’s just 45 nautical miles from international waters and about 27 kilometers away from the Luchao Port in Nanhui District. The Donghai Bridge links the port with Shanghai’s network of communication lines and gives it good connections with the economic hinterland of the Yangtze Rive Delta.
It is the largest container port in China and the largest artificial island harbour in the World. Built to circumvent growth limitations for the Port of Shanghai as a result of shallow waters, it allows berths with depths of up to 15 meters to be built, and is capable of handling the largest container ships today.

Stop At: Dishui Lake, Lingang New City, Pudong District, Shanghai 201300 China

Dishui Lake is a landmark project in the main urban area of Shanghai Lingang New City. The main urban area is the urban comprehensive life service area with 5.6 km² Dishui Lake as its center. And Dishui Lake is the existing largest artificial freshwater lake in China.
It is the representative project located in the Shanghai New City area.
